Re: metacommentary, I think a fair amount of getting screwed over for no reason, or at least options that would lead to that, is necessary to maintain the integrity of the WH40K world. A major theme is that the galaxy is a horrible place, full of horrible things that want to do horrible shit, for reasons that appear unfathomable to us. Acting rationally won't always end well when there are 5+ other factions expecting you to act rationally and plotting your destruction on that basis. As for making choices more divisive, I agree with treave; I'd add only that hard choices tend to be a product of limited information, with evidence in support of each option offered to us. A complete lack of info leads to blind in-character decisions; an overabundance makes the choices trivial. We haven't been very clear on what's up with the galaxy during this intro, so creating hard choices while delivering exposition is tricky; presumably, it'll get easier once the groundwork is established.
